3. Ingredients You’ll Need

  • 1 pound ground beef
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 medium onion, chopped
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• ¼ te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 (14.5 ounce) can crushed tomatoes
  • 1 cup orzo pasta
  • 2 cups chicken broth
  • ½ cup heavy cream
  • ¼ c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• Fresh basil, for garnish (optional)

4. Step-by-Step Instructions

Let’s walk through how to make this delicious dish. It’s easier than you might think!

Step 1: Brown the Ground Beef

In a large skillet or pot, heat the olive oil over medium-high heat. Add the ground beef, chopped onion, and minced garlic. Cook, breaking up the beef with a spoon, until the beef is browned and the onion is softened. Drain any excess grease. Stir in the Italian seasoning, salt, and pepper. This step builds a crucial flavor base for the entire dish. Be sure to break the beef up really well!

Step 2: Add Orzo and Broth

Stir in the crushed tomatoes and orzo pasta into the skillet with the browned beef. Pour in the chicken broth. Bring the mixture to a boil, then reduce the heat to low, cover, and simmer for 15-20 minutes, or until the orzo is cooked through and the liquid is absorbed. This is where the magic happens! The orzo soaks up all the delicious flavors from the beef, tomatoes, and broth. Keep an eye on the liquid levels and stir occasionally to prevent sticking.

Step 3: Stir in Cream and Cheese

Remove the skillet from the heat. Stir in the heavy cream and Parmesan cheese until well combined. The sauce should be creamy and smooth. Taste and adjust seasoning as needed. This step adds richness and depth to the sauce. Don’t be afraid to add a little extra Parmesan if you’re a cheese lover! For a richer flavor, consider using freshly grated Parmesan.

Step 4: Serve and Garnish

Serve the ground beef orzo recipe hot. Garnish with fresh basil, if desired. This dish is delicious on its own or served with a side salad or garlic bread. A sprinkle of red pepper flakes can add a touch of heat, or a dollop of ricotta cheese can provide extra creaminess.

5. Tips and Variations

Want to customize this ground beef orzo recipe? Here are a few ideas:

  • **Add Vegetables:** Mix in vegetables like diced bell peppers, zucchini, or spinach for added nutrients and flavor.
  • **Spice It Up:** Add a pinch of red pepper flakes or a dash of hot sauce for a spicy kick.
  • **Use Different Meat:** Substitute ground beef with ground turkey or Italian sausage for a different flavor profile.
  • **Cheese Variations:** Try using mozzarella, cheddar, or provolone cheese instead of Parmesan.
  • **Make It Vegetarian:** Omit the ground beef and add more vegetables or plant-based protein.

8. Storage Instructions

To store leftovers, allow the ground beef orzo with tomato cream sauce to cool completely. Transfer it to an airtight container and refrigerate for up to 3-4 days. To reheat, simply microwave until heated through, or warm it up in a skillet over medium heat, adding a splash of broth or water if needed to prevent sticking.
